Audley secures £40m Homes England loan
Audley Group has gained a £40m funding injection from Homes England, which will be used to speed up the construction of 255 retirement homes.
The loan, from the £4.5bn Home Building Fund, will finance works for the first homes within Audley Group’s mid-market Mayfield Villages portfolio.
Located in Watford, Hertfordshire, the first retirement village will include health, wellbeing, care and leisure facilities. Owners and members of the local area will also be able to access its Care Quality Commission-rated care provision.

Peter Denton, chief executive at Homes England, said: “First and foremost, this will enable hundreds of later life customers to enjoy high-quality, independent living accommodation for years to come. The area will benefit from enhanced care provision and family homes will be freed up for the next generation.
“Our loan directly addresses market funding challenges due to the pandemic and highlights our commitment to ensuring diverse communities.”
Nick Sanderson, chief executive of Audley Group, said: “The transaction with Homes England is an important milestone for the retirement living sector. A coming of age. Government backing underlines the importance placed on increasing provision in the retirement living sector and developing more innovative housing solutions.
“Our aspiration to transform retirement is shared with both Homes England and BlackRock Real Assets and this will be the focus as we look to the future.”
The development forms part of the wider Riverwell regeneration scheme in Watford. The project also incorporates modern methods of construction, covering build and project management activities.
